August 2023 by Athif Ahmed
If you're living in New Westminster and do your grocery shopping near Royal City Center, then I highly recommend you buying all your fruits over here .I have been living in New West for almost 5 years and split my grocery shopping between Safeway and Walmart.I stopped by Kin's Farm Market here last week and felt like I should have started buying my fruits from them a long time ago. They are so much more affordable than Safeway and have the same great quality.I purchased a quarter of a watermelon today with some blueberries and paid around 10 dollars for both. I would have easily payed three times as much for those in Safeway.It is safe to say that I will be purchasing most of my fruits from Kin's here on out :)

April 2023 by Karen L
Love this place. I do my fruit and veggie shopping here before heading downstairs to Save On to get the rest of my groceries. The produce here is always fresh, much fresher than Save On. The prices are good too, some items sometimes a bit more than Save On, sometimes a bit less but the difference is negligible and the quality can't be beat.
